Nuclear fuel assembly

Description

Purpose: To enable to average the releasing amount of gaseous nuclear fission products from fuel pellets on each of nuclear fuel elements. Constitution: In a nuclear fuel assembly comprising a plurality of nuclear fuel elements bundled together each composed of a fuel can sealingly filled with nuclear fuel substances, the amount of inert gases to be sealed previously within the fuel cans, in at least one of fuel elements incorporated with burnable poisons and nuclear fuel elements situated in adjacent with control rods, is made larger than the amount of the inert gas incorporated within the fuel cans in other nuclear fuel elements. In such a constitution, release of the gaseous fission products from the fuel pellets due to the relative power-up can be suppressed. (Aizawa, K.)
